"Holograph, signed with initials. Letter written in pencil. William Lloyd Garrison had a very uncomfortable train ride from Boston to Syracuse and was much annoyed by the heat, smoke, and dust. Garrison writes: \"I have never travelled so rapidly before--averaging at least 35 miles an hour the whole distance.\" He stayed with Mr. Wilkinson, whose home he praises. He tells about Samuel Joseph May's funeral. He went to visit Mr. and Mrs. Wright in Auburn, New York, and will go to see Gerrit Smith after he leaves there."
title
"Letter from William Lloyd Garrison, Syracuse, [N.Y.], to Helen Eliza Garrison, July 7, 1871"
